Mexican Quesadilla Casserole

  1. Gather the ingredients.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Coat a 9x13-inch baking dish with cooking spray.

  2.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add beef and onion; cook and stir until beef is completely browned, 5 to 7 minutes. Drain and discard grease.

  3. Stir tomato sauce, black beans, diced tomatoes, corn, and chopped green chiles into ground beef mixture; season with chili powder, cumin, garlic, oregano, and pepper flakes. Reduce heat to low; simmer for 5 minutes.

  4. Spread about ½ cup beef mixture into the prepared baking dish; top with 3 tortillas, overlapping as needed. Spread ½ cup beef mixture over tortillas; sprinkle with 1 cup Cheddar cheese. Repeat layering once more with remaining 3 tortillas, beef mixture, and Cheddar cheese.

  5. Bake in the preheated oven until cheese melts and mixture is heated through, about 15 minutes. Cool briefly before serving.

  6. Serve and enjoy!
